    • There’s never a good time to go on a sabbatical. Something else will always be happening, but I go because I see the blessings and benefits of it, even if it’s just for two or three days.
    • Find a place where you’re not easily distracted. It doesn’t have to be a freezing cabin in the woods, but it should be somewhere you and God can be alone.
    • Start preparing for your sabbatical about a week ahead of time. Begin to consciously slow down your mind and thoughts so you will be prepared to focus on the Lord rather than work, projects, and issues.
    • Bring plenty of paper, pens, pencils, and highlighters.

  6. Jul 8, 2020 · A sabbatical allows a pastor to be a gospel recipient – to hear the Word of God preached to him without being responsible for the rest of the service. It allows for family renewal time. Even the strongest ministry families I know need intentional time alone to reinvest in each other.
